Overview

A communication network is the backbone of modern digital interactions, enabling seamless data exchange across devices and locations. It consists of hardware (routers, switches, cables) and software (protocols, management systems) working in unison. Networks can be wired (fiber optics, Ethernet) or wireless (5G, Wi-Fi), each offering distinct advantages for different use cases. In B2B environments, communication networks are critical for operations, supporting everything from cloud computing to real-time collaboration. Enterprises often deploy hybrid networks combining public and private infrastructures to balance cost, performance, and security.

Key Features

Scalability is a defining feature, allowing networks to expand with organizational growth. Modular designs and software-defined networking (SDN) enable flexible resource allocation. Reliability is ensured through redundancy, failover mechanisms, and service-level agreements (SLAs) guaranteeing uptime. Security features like encryption, firewalls, and intrusion detection systems protect sensitive data. High-speed transfer rates, measured in gigabits per second (Gbps), are achieved via fiber optics or advanced wireless standards like 5G. Latency optimization is crucial for applications like VoIP or financial trading.

Application Areas

Telecommunications providers rely on vast networks to deliver voice and data services globally. Enterprises use local area networks (LANs) and wide area networks (WANs) to connect offices and data centers. IoT ecosystems depend on low-power networks (LPWAN) for sensor connectivity. Smart cities deploy networks for traffic management, public safety, and utility monitoring. Industrial automation leverages deterministic networks with ultra-low latency for robotics and control systems. Emerging applications include edge computing and private 5G networks for specialized industries like manufacturing or healthcare.

Precautions

Cybersecurity is paramount; networks must comply with standards like ISO 27001 or NIST frameworks. Regular vulnerability assessments and employee training mitigate risks. Bandwidth planning prevents congestion, especially for data-intensive tasks like video conferencing or backups. Hardware compatibility ensures seamless integration with legacy systems. Environmental factors (e.g., electromagnetic interference) affect wireless performance. Contracts should specify maintenance responsibilities and response times for outages. Compliance with regional regulations (e.g., GDPR for data routing) is mandatory.

B2B Procurement Guide

Evaluate vendors based on proven track records in your industry. Request case studies or pilot deployments to test performance. Total cost of ownership (TCO) should account for licensing, hardware, and ongoing maintenance. For large-scale deployments, consider managed services providers (MSPs) offering 24/7 monitoring. SLAs should define penalties for downtime. Modular architectures future-proof investments. Open standards (e.g., Open RAN) reduce vendor lock-in. Reference pricing: Small business solutions start at ~$10,000; enterprise-grade setups exceed $1M.
